Description

This form is designed for use between Trim Carpenter Contractors and Property Owners and may be executed with either a cost plus or fixed fee payment arrangement. This contract addresses such matters as change orders, work site information, warranty and insurance. This form was specifically drafted to comply with the laws of the State of Kansas.

A Trim Carpenter Contract for Contractors in Overland Park, Kansas is a legal agreement that outlines the terms and conditions between a contractor and a client for the provision of trim carpentry services. This contract is specifically tailored to ensure a smooth working relationship and accurate execution of trim carpentry projects in the Overland Park area. Different types of trim carpenter contracts for contractors can typically include: 1. Residential Trim Carpenter Contract: This type of contract is designed for trim carpenters who specialize in residential projects. It covers the installation and repair of various trim elements like baseboards, crown moldings, door frames, window casings, and other decorative enhancements in residential properties. 2. Commercial Trim Carpenter Contract: Commercial trim carpentry contracts are aimed at contractors who primarily work on commercial construction projects. These projects generally involve larger-scale trim installations in office buildings, retail spaces, hotels, and other commercial establishments. 3. Custom Trim Carpenter Contract: Some Overland Park contractors specialize in custom trim carpentry, creating unique and intricate designs according to the client's specifications. This contract typically includes detailed discussions regarding design concepts, project scope, materials to be used, timelines, and any customizations required. 4. Maintenance and Repair Trim Carpenter Contract: This type of contract is specifically for contractors who provide maintenance and repair services for trim carpentry projects. The contract will outline the responsibilities of the contractor, including regular inspections, preventive maintenance, and timely repairs. An Overland Park Kansas Trim Carpenter Contract for Contractors would include essential details such as project scope, start and completion dates, payment terms, subcontractor agreements (if applicable), insurance requirements, warranties, dispute resolution mechanisms, and any other specific project requirements. It is crucial for both the contractor and the client to carefully review the contract and agree upon its terms before commencing any trim carpentry work to ensure a successful and legally protected project.
